What you'll be doing The Emergency Management services provide advisory services for the district in responding to major incidents and similar threats to the Northern Sydney communities, including bushfires, explosions, chemical, biological and radiological incidents and civil unrest. The position is central to the planning, coordination, system design, testing, education, response, debrief and improvement of the system.

The Manager, Emergency Management Unit is responsible for developing, implementing, coordinating and overseeing the operations of the District’s Emergency Management and Business Continuity Program in Northern Sydney Local Health District (NSLHD). The Manager, in an advisory capacity, is responsible, with the District’s Health Service Functional Area Coordinator (HSFAC), for the operational integrity and strategic deployment of the Emergency Management planning, response and recovery systems.

The position involves extensive collaboration with external agencies, including NSW State Health State Preparedness and Response Unit, emergency agencies, other Local Health District’s, private health providers and government agencies. This position will also have overall carriage of Business Continuity Management and has a support function for Critical Infrastructure Management for NSLHD.
